
Peplow House in Peplow, Market Drayton, is a well presented period farmhouse surrounded by unspoilt North Shropshire countryside. The house has been refurbished to an extremely high standard and comprises a reception hall, cloakroom, sitting room, drawing room, dining room, kitchen/breakfast room, utility room, five bedrooms and two bathrooms.
Outside the property offers an octagonal dairy house, substantial barn, summer house, beautiful part wooded and landscaped gardens, grounds and paddock extending to approx 1.86 acres.
